.home{--accent:#F79256;--accent-deep:#E07A3D;--bg:#FBFAF7;--bg-soft:#F2EFE8;--bg-card:#FFFFFF;--ink:#1F2937;--ink-soft:#4B5563;--ink-mute:#9CA3AF;--line:rgba(31,41,55,.08);--invert:#1F2937;--invert-ink:#FBFAF7;--heading:'Fraunces',serif;background:var(--bg);color:var(--ink);font-family:'Inter',system-ui,sans-serif;min-height:100vh}.home a{color:inherit;text-decoration:none}.home .h-mono{font-family:'JetBrains Mono',monospace;font-size:11px;letter-spacing:.2em;text-transform:uppercase;color:var(--ink-soft)}.home .h-eyebrow{display:inline-flex;align-items:center;gap:12px}.home .h-eyebrow::before{content:"";width:28px;height:1px;background:currentColor;opacity:.5}